Soil
a complex plant-supporting system made up of minerals, organic material, water and air
Parent Material
the base geological material in a particular location
Bedrock
mass of solid rock that makes up Earth's crust
Weathering
physical and chemical processes that breaks downs rocks and minerals into smaller particles
4 ways of soil formation...
Weathering, erosion, deposition and decomposition
Deposition
drop off of eroded material at a new location
Decomposition
breakdown of waste, organisms and organic material into simple molecules
Soil Horizons (definition)
distinct layer of soil
Soil Profile
a cross-section of all soil horizons in a specific soil, from surface to bedrock
Soil Horizon Order & Descriptions...
O Horizon (litter layer)
A Horizon (top soil)
E Horizon (leaching layer)
B Horizon (subsoil)
C Horizon (weathered parent material)
R Horizon (parent material)
Soil Composition is Influenced by...
Climate
Organisms
Land Forms
Parent Materials
and Time
Soil Groups are further classified by...
Color
Structure
pH
& Texture
